Specifications
| Spec | RONGCHUANG Ultrasonic Toothbrush for Adults - Automatic | WILDWELLO U-Shaped Electric Toothbrush, Food-Grade |
|---|---|---|
| Charging | Wireless | Magnetic |
| Modes | 4 | 4 |
| Material | Food-grade silicone | Food-grade silicone |
| Water Resistance | IPX7 | IPX7 |
| Vibrations | High-frequency | 48,000 VPM |

Design and Ergonomics
When it comes to design, the Ultrasonic Toothbrush for Adults features a unique U-shape that matches the natural contours of your teeth, enhancing its cleaning effectiveness. In contrast, the WILDWELLO U-Shaped Electric Toothbrush also boasts a 360° ergonomic brush head, designed for a seamless fit that promotes thorough cleaning. Both toothbrushes prioritize user comfort and functionality, but the Ultrasonic Toothbrush's design is particularly aimed at maximizing contact with teeth and gums through high-frequency vibrations.
Cleaning Performance
The Ultrasonic Toothbrush for Adults promises a significant cleaning advantage, claiming to improve gum health up to 100% more than a manual toothbrush. It operates with a powerful motor that delivers high-frequency vibrations, making it capable of achieving three times the cleanliness compared to traditional brushes. On the other hand, the WILDWELLO toothbrush offers up to 48,000 vibrations per minute, which allows for gentle cleaning of tooth surfaces while caring for enamel and gums. While both toothbrushes offer impressive cleaning capabilities, the Ultrasonic Toothbrush claims a more profound impact on gum health.
Modes and Customization
The Ultrasonic Toothbrush has multi-function modes tailored for diverse needs: powerful brushing, comfortable brushing, gum massage, and whitening. This comprehensive approach allows users to address various dental concerns. In comparison, the WILDWELLO U-Shaped Toothbrush features four distinct modes—Standard Clean, High-Efficiency Clean, Brighten, and Gentle Massage—providing a customizable brushing experience. While both products offer multiple modes, the Ultrasonic Toothbrush's whitening feature, which requires a gel for optimal effect, adds an extra layer of versatility for those seeking brighter teeth.
Battery Life and Charging
In terms of battery life, the Ultrasonic Toothbrush for Adults can operate for a week after just three hours of charging, showcasing its efficiency and suitability for travel. It employs a wireless charging base and includes a low battery reminder for convenience. Alternatively, the WILDWELLO toothbrush uses a magnetic contact dock for quick and tidy charging, but it does not specify its battery life. While both toothbrushes offer modern charging methods, the Ultrasonic Toothbrush stands out with its robust battery performance and user-friendly charging options.
Materials and Durability
Both toothbrushes prioritize quality materials for user safety and durability. The Ultrasonic Toothbrush is made from food-grade silicone and ABS, ensuring it is environmentally friendly and safe for oral use. It also exhibits super water resistance, making it washable and reusable. The WILDWELLO U-Shaped Toothbrush also utilizes food-grade silicone and boasts an IPX7 water-resistant rating, allowing it to withstand rinsing and even use in the shower. While both products emphasize durability and hygiene, the Ultrasonic Toothbrush's design for ease of cleaning is particularly noteworthy.
Portability and Travel Suitability
For travelers, the Ultrasonic Toothbrush for Adults is designed with portability in mind, featuring a compact design and wireless charging that makes it easy to pack. Additionally, its timer function can help maintain consistent brushing habits even on the go. The WILDWELLO toothbrush, while also portable, does not specifically highlight travel-friendly features. The Ultrasonic Toothbrush's clear focus on convenience during travel gives it an edge for users who frequently find themselves on the move.
Pricing and Value
Price-wise, the Ultrasonic Toothbrush for Adults is currently priced at $27.99, while the WILDWELLO U-Shaped Electric Toothbrush is available for $19.99. This makes the WILDWELLO approximately 29% cheaper than the Ultrasonic Toothbrush. However, the higher price of the Ultrasonic model is justified by its additional features, such as more cleaning modes and longer battery life. Thus, while the WILDWELLO offers a more budget-friendly option, the Ultrasonic Toothbrush may deliver greater value for those seeking enhanced dental care.
